Fox Brothers Holdings, a private equity-backed construction materials firm headquartered in Blackpool, has expanded with the acquisition of a North West civil engineering contractor. The acquisition of NMS Civil Engineering is Fox Group’s second acquisition since it was bought by Stellex Capital Management in September 2024.
NMS Civil Engineering is an established contractor, delivering key services in civil engineering, recycling, road planing and barriers. The acquisition is the latest step in Fox Group’s move to establish itself as a fully integrated circular construction materials business supplying sustainable solutions to the construction sector.
The acquisition is effective from September 2025 and is aligned with Fox Group’s strategy of driving both organic and inorganic growth. NMS, which is a key regional player in the North West’s circular construction market, is expected to drive significant synergies for the group. Potential synergies include the use of recycled asphalt planings in the group’s asphalt production process. Fox Group’s new £4 million Leyland Asphalt plant opened in July 2025.
Fox Group Chief Executive Paul Fox said that with the acquisition, the group “will build on our recent expansion and further broaden our circular offering to customers bringing our annual use of recycled products close to 2 million tonnes.”
He continued: "NMS has a strong management team, and we welcome them and their colleagues as we continue with our growth plans. We are committed to a smooth transition for the teams and customers of NMS and we anticipate success and growth through this synergistic partnership.”
Roger Thistlethwaite, director at NMS, added: “Joining the Fox Group will enable us to work with their expansive network and resources, providing significant opportunity to grow and meet the increasing demand for RAP.”
"The support and partnership from the team at the Fox Group will help further our mission to drive circularity and sustainability throughout our business.”
